Document Description
The Safety Element update follows the requirements of Section 65302(g) of the California Government Code, which mandates that a Safety Element contain background information and policies to address multiple natural hazards, an analysis of vulnerabilities from climate change, policies to improve climate change resilience, and an assessment of residential areas with evacuation constraints. The Safety Element update covers the following safety issues: seismic and geologic hazards, hazardous waste and materials, flood and inundation hazards, fire hazards, extreme heat and severe weather, drought, human health hazards, and emergency preparedness and response. The Safety Element update is a programmatic document, which provides strategies to address public safety and resilience issues and would not result in an increase in development capacity in the City. The project includes an Addendum to the City of El Cerrito General Plan EIR (State Clearinghouse Number 1999022058) for the adopted Environmental Impact Report for the City of El Cerrito General Plan Update.
